ясла
Ukrainian
Etymology
Inherited from Old East Slavic ꙗсли (jasli), from Proto-Slavic *jasli. Cognate with Russian я́сли (jásli).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): [ˈjɑslɐ]
Noun
я́сла • (jásla) n inan pl (genitive я́сел or ясе́л, plural only)
- (agriculture) manger
- nursery, crèche (daytime institution caring for toddlers)
- Synonym: дитячі я́сла (dytjači jásla)
